Russian pop singer Valeriya, a staunch supporter of Vladimir Putin, continues to provoke with her performances. In Ukraine, she sang a patriotic song amidst bombed-out buildings destroyed by Russian forces. The Ukrainian Ministry of Culture is taking action, urging the Security Service to determine the recording's location. Meanwhile, anti-Putin campaigners in the UK petition Downing Street to ban Valeriya from performing at the Albert Hall, branding her a propaganda tool. The controversy highlights cultural tensions surrounding artists linked to Russia amidst ongoing war and political unrest.
What actions has the Ukrainian Ministry of Culture taken against Valeriya?
The Ukrainian Ministry of Culture plans to appeal to the Security Service of Ukraine (SSU) to identify the exact locations where Valeriya recorded her controversial performances. They aim to address the implications of her performances set against bombed buildings, which are seen as provocative amidst the ongoing conflict.
Why are anti-Putin campaigners concerned about Valeriya performing in the UK?
Anti-Putin campaigners argue that Valeriya and similar artists serve as propaganda tools for Russia, which is accused of violating international agreements. Her planned performance in the UK is viewed as controversial, and they have petitioned to bar her from the country to prevent the spread of pro-Putin messages.
Who is Valeriya and what is her stance on the war in Ukraine?
Valeriya is a Russian pop singer known for her support of Vladimir Putin and his policies. She openly backs Russia's actions in Ukraine, which include military operations and outright support of their outcomes. Her performances amidst bombed landscapes have been interpreted as an endorsement of Russian aggression.
